AIS Aids to Navigation (AtoN)
AIS used as or on an aid to navigation (AtoN) uses this basic format 9192M3I4D5X6X7X8X9, where the digits 3, 4 and 5 represent the MID and X is any figure from 0 to 9. See Types of AIS and AIS Frequently Asked Questions #21 for instructions on applying for a Private AIS Aids to Navigation station.
